Ticket: Config drift on metrics sidecar

The Pulsewick metrics-aggregation sidecar on the Harkfield cluster has drifted from the values checked into the deploy repo. Flush intervals and buffer sizes were hand-edited during last month's incident and never reverted. New team members: do not copy settings from running pods. The approved baseline is below, and the sidecar should match it exactly.

settings of bawif-fawif:
ralix:
  log_level: warn
  metrics_host: metrics.ralix.tolvaqsys.internal
  pool_size: 32

Facilities Ticket — Cleaning Crew Access, Brindle Annex

For new starters handling evening lock-up: the Sorano Cleaning crew arrives nightly at 21:30 via the annex side door. Check their rota sheet, note arrival in the log, and ensure the storeroom is relocked afterward. To let them through the side door, enter the access code below.

badge for yaweg-hafog: bdg-GX-6

Subject: FareLogic on-call

You're reviewing changes to FareLogic, our shipping-fee rules engine. Key points: rules are versioned, never edited in place. Reject any PR that mutates an active ruleset. Pages usually mean a rule evaluation timeout — check the regex-heavy zone rules first. Rollback is one command. The review checklist and rollback procedure are documented on this page:

wiki page, tahaf-tajog: https://jira.ordindyn.corp/pipeline